Central Sterile Instrument Supervisor Resume Examples & Samples

  • Supervises daily operations and work of Outpatient Surgery Sterile Processing Technicians
  • Manages the inventory of on hand instrumentation maintained in the Adult Sterile Processing areas
  • Researches manufacturers, alternatives in specialty instruments and creates ordering invoices for all service lines of instrumentation
  • Collaborates with OR and Unit Service Line Supervisors to ensure the instrument needs of all service lines are met in a timely and accurate manner
  • Monitors and coordinates instrument needs with OR and Unit Service Line Supervisors and Coordinators
  • Tracks and reports all instrument and equipment repairs
  • Updates the Impress Connect tracking system with instrument descriptions, pictures and training videos, is the onsite system expert
  • Monitors and tracks all count sheet changes report out at Periop and system meetings with SPD Director. Identifies trends and report out. Will address and lead process improvement efforts associated with trends reported on
  • Creates new sets and associated count sheets on an as needed
  • Consolidation of sets on an “as identified” basis
  • Maintenance and training of Impress Connect instrument tracking system
  • Monitors quality assurance of sets
  • Maintains cleaning, disinfection and sterilization standards in tracking system
  • Ensures that instruments are marked for easy identification and tracking purposes
  • Marking of baskets and associated containers with bar codes for tracking system
  • Responsible for monitoring and ordering all departmental supplies
  • Manages departmental projects as assigned by Director as needed. Works on other projects as identified by department Director or Manager lead role in LEAN SPD events
  • Attends OUMC meeting with SPD Director as deemed appropriate by Director
  • Manage consignment instrument inventory
  • Manage Loaner inventory
  • Manage Stock of Dept
  • Assist OR/SPD staff related to Impress Connect system issues as this person is the in-house content expert
  • Assist Stryker/Onsite support when needed as it pertains to Impress system and instrumentation needs associated with their area of support
  • Manage Kronos for the ASC/ Adult SPD staff to ensure there time is correct prior to approval is a back up to SPD Director
  • Manages OSC Impress system
  • Build all new instrument sets

Electrical & Instrument Supervisor Resume Examples & Samples

  • Maintain a daily diary, which shall record accomplishments, problems, manpower and equipment usage
  • Identify and resolve as necessary interface issues between contractors
  • Monitor and record the number of contractor employees on site
  • Plan and co-ordinate resources and equipment for the field tasks to conduct the work in a safe, timely and cost effective manner
  • Provide regular feedback to the Construction Manager/Construction Superintendent on progress, achievements, safety and quality related issues
  • Ensure that the standard of workmanship and the materials/equipment is compliant with the specifications and that specified inspections and tests are conducted and records maintained to substantiate conformance
  • Ensure correct material, machinery, equipment and personnel are available and suitable for completion of work
  • Assess risks and hazards involved in tasks and methods to manage the hazards in order to prevent incidents, injury and damage
  • Monitor employee health and fitness and address any inconsistencies with the Site Safety Advisor
  • Performance of multi-skilled craft workers in the installation, repair, preventive maintenance, removal, or adjustment of equipment or components in accordance with established project procedures, requirements and specifications
  • Determination of daily work schedules; coordinates the human resources, materials, and information needed to accomplish the work consistent with efficient operation
  • Assists in or performs interpretation of engineering drawings, work orders, specifications and manufacturer’s technical data materials. Also assists or performs diagnostics of equipment failures and recommends solutions
  • Approves completed work orders and stores requisitions for materials
  • Responsible for quantity and condition of assigned tools and equipment
  • While supervising others, has responsibility for the safety of those being supervised, and ensures that they comply with established safety policies and procedures, and practice safe work habits
  • Observes work in progress to ensure that procedures are followed and materials used conform to specifications
  • Examines workmanship of finished installations for conformity to standards; approves installations
  • Establish effective communications with the Client's field representative, through discussions, and such other arrangements as are required to maintain close working relationships
